Rosalie A. (Sanders) Hockensmith, 75, passed Tuesday, January 6, 2026, at her home. She was the wife of Wayne F. Hockensmith, her husband of 54 years.

Rosalie was born May 30, 1950, in Gettysburg, the daughter of the late Earl F. and Cathern V. (Welty) Sanders.

Rosalie was a 1969 graduate of Delone Catholic High School, and was a member of Sacred Heart Basilica, Hanover. She was employed at Kmart for 20 years, then at Delias until her retirement.

In addition to her husband Wayne, Rosalie is survived by a son, Joseph Hockensmith and his wife Christine of Littlestown, a daughter, Kerry Bly of Hanover, six grandchildren, Jacob Hockensmith, Wyatt Hockensmith, Cadence Hockensmith, Creek Hockensmith, Reno Bly and his fiancé Sheryl Stockman, and Skylar Bly, two step grandchildren, Janna (Monn) Rippeon and Alisha Oyler, a great grandson, Haycelin Hockensmith, three step great grandchildren, Lyric, Arrow and Winter, numerous nieces and nephews, five brothers, Christopher Sanders and his wife Eileen of Littlestown, James Sanders of Littlestown, Stephen Sanders and his wife Tae-Cha of Hanover, Anthony Sanders and his wife Teresa of Aspers, and Timothy Sanders and his wife Jenny of Gardners, two sisters, Cecilia Elliot and her husband Christopher of New Oxford, and Bernadette Graybill and her husband Gary of Spring Grove, and a sister-in-law, Linda Krout and her husband Dean of Gettysburg. She was predeceased by a daughter, LeeAnn M. Hockensmith, and a brother, Earl F. Sanders, Jr.

A Mass of Christian Burial will be held on Monday, January 12, 2026, at 10 AM, at Sacred Heart Basilica, 30 Basilica Dr, Hanover, with Rev. Dwight Schlaline officiating. Burial will be in the church cemetery. A viewing will be held on Sunday, from 6-8 PM, at Feiser Funeral & Cremation Care, Inc, 302 Lincoln Way West, New Oxford, with prayers at 8 PM.
